Explore the surprising realities of CPR survival rates and the potential for improvement in this 20-minute TEDx talk by Dr. C. 'Nat' Nataraj. Discover why current CPR outcomes are less effective than commonly believed and learn about innovative approaches using machine learning to enhance this life-saving technique. Gain insights into Dr. Nataraj's latest research findings and his call to action for fellow researchers to optimize CPR practices. As the Moritz Endowed Professor in Engineered Systems at Villanova University and leader of the Villanova Center for Analytics of Dynamic Systems, Dr. Nataraj brings expertise in nonlinear dynamics of engineering and biomedical systems to this critical discussion on protecting human life.
